In Arizona criminal law, “Psychiatrist” is a term defined by statute rather than by its everyday meaning. Its statutory definition — quoted verbatim below — controls how the term is applied throughout the Arizona criminal code.
What does “Psychiatrist” mean in Arizona criminal law?
"Psychiatrist" means a person who is licensed pursuant to title 32, chapter 13 or 17. 10. (A.R.S. § 8-271)
